WebA United States military occupation code, or a military occupational specialty code (MOS code), is a nine character code used in the United States Army and United States Marines to identify a specific job. In the United States Air Force, a system of Air Force Specialty Codes (AFSC) is used. In the United States Navy, a system of naval ratings and designators is … Web24 Aug 2024 · MOS Code 11C. Web5 Nov 2024 · By. Rod Powers. Updated on 11/05/18. A Fire Support Specialist is a member of the Army's field artillery team. Artillery are weapons that fire large ammunition, rockets or missiles to support infantry and tank units in combat.
